Ceramic PCBs are one more noteworthy innovation in PCB innovation, understood for their exceptional thermal conductivity, mechanical toughness, and electrical insulation properties. Normally used in high-performance applications, such as RF circuits and high-frequency tools, ceramic PCBs can deal with severe temperatures and rough environmental problems. Their robustness and dependability make them an ideal option for applications in telecoms, automobile, and aerospace sectors where performance and long life are paramount. The benefits of ceramic PCBs encompass enhanced signal stability and reduced electromagnetic interference, making them an exceptional selection for vital digital applications. High-frequency PCBs stand for an additional crucial section of the marketplace, especially designed to manage regularities over 1 GHz. These boards are designed with distinct products and techniques to reduce signal loss and crosstalk. Applications in telecoms, radar systems, and microwave tools count greatly on high-frequency PCBs to ensure dependable performance. As the need for high-speed information transmission and reliable interaction systems continues to grow, the need for high-frequency PCB producing ends up being a lot more obvious. Suppliers of high-frequency PCBs require specialized knowledge and progressed screening abilities to make sure that the products made use of can execute properly under the stress of high-frequency applications. By focusing on using products such as PTFE and various other low-loss dielectrics, along with meticulous fabrication processes, these producers can create PCBs that satisfy the strict demands of modern electronic applications.
